What is 100 Mesh Mica Powder?

Mica is a naturally occurring mineral silicate. The term "100 mesh" refers to the particle size – meaning the powder has been processed so that most particles pass through a sieve with 100 openings per linear inch. This results in a relatively fine powder with a consistent particle size distribution. This fineness contributes to its excellent dispersion properties and ability to create smooth, even finishes. Applications of 100 Mesh Mica Powder

The diverse properties of 100 mesh mica powder allow it to be used in a wide array of applications. In the paint and coatings industry, it provides improved durability, weather resistance, and a pearlescent sheen. It’s a critical component in plastic manufacturing, enhancing dimensional stability and reducing shrinkage. The cosmetics industry utilizes it for its light-reflecting qualities, creating shimmering effects in makeup products. Furthermore, it finds application as a filler in drilling fluids within the oil and gas industry, where its inertness and resistance to high temperatures are crucial.

100 Mesh Mica Powder vs. Other Mesh Sizes: A Comparison

Different mesh sizes of mica powder are suited for different applications. A coarser mesh, like 60 mesh, is often used as a filler where aesthetics are less important and bulk is needed. Finer meshes, such as 200 mesh or even micronized mica, offer even greater dispersion and smoothness, ideal for high-end cosmetic formulations or specialized coatings. 100 mesh strikes a balance between these extremes, providing good dispersion with reasonable bulk. The choice of mesh size depends heavily on the desired end-product characteristics.

Mesh Size Particle Size (approx.) Typical Applications
60 Mesh Coarse Bulk filler, construction materials
100 Mesh Fine Paints, coatings, plastics, some cosmetics
200 Mesh Very Fine High-end cosmetics, specialized coatings

How should I store 100 mesh mica powder to maintain its quality?

To preserve the quality of 100 mesh mica powder, store it in a cool, dry, and well-ventilated area. Keep it sealed in its original packaging or in an airtight container to prevent moisture absorption. Avoid exposure to direct sunlight and extreme temperatures. Proper storage will ensure the powder remains free-flowing and maintains its optimal performance characteristics.

Can 100 mesh mica powder be used in direct contact with food?

While mica is generally considered inert, the grade of mica powder used in industrial applications like paints and plastics is not certified for direct food contact. Using food-grade mica specifically designed and certified for food applications is crucial if direct contact with food is intended. Please consult with regulatory bodies and relevant certifications for food-grade mica before considering its use in food-related products.
